Charleston County Consolidated 9-1-1 Center Receives APCO Agency Training Program Certification

APCO International March 22, 2016 APCO

Alexandria, VA – Charleston County Consolidated 9-1-1 Center, SC, has met the minimum training standards for the Association of Public-Safety Communications Officials (APCO) International Agency Training Program Certification and has been awarded certification as of March 15, 2016.

Public safety agencies utilize the APCO International Agency Training Program Certification as a formal mechanism to ensure their training programs meet APCO American National Standards (ANS). Initial and continuing training for public safety telecommunicators is important as they provide essential services to the public in an expanding and rapidly changing environment.

“America’s public safety communications agencies represent the first tier of emergency response,” said APCO International’s President Brent Lee. “Ensuring that training programs and procedures are current, comprehensive, and effective is a key element to success in this role. Achieving APCO Agency Training Program Certification is proof of an agency’s commitment to excellence and of their dedication to the communities they serve.”

APCO International® (www.apcointl.org)
APCO International is the world’s oldest and largest organization of public safety communications professionals and supports the largest U.S. membership base of any public safety association. It serves the needs of public safety communications practitioners worldwide – and the welfare of the general public as a whole – by providing complete expertise, professional development, technical assistance, advocacy and outreach.
